100-Percent First-Time Pass Rate for Student Psychiatric Mental Health鈥揘urse Practitioners
CategoriesPublished:The demand for skilled psychiatric mental health nurse practitioners is growing and 糖心传媒 graduates are ready to answer the call. Adelphi has announced a 100-percent first-time pass rate for graduates who took the ANCC Psychiatric鈥揗ental Health Nurse Practitioner board certification exam in 2020.

Published:Food insecurity is defined as 鈥渓imited or uncertain availability of nutritionally adequate foods, including involuntarily cutting back on meals and food portions or not knowing the source of the next meal." It鈥檚 one of the most pressing issues of our times. Anyone can experience food insecurity, including college students, faculty and staff.
